A stick figure animation made using Microsoft PowerPoint 2016. Microsoft PowerPoint animation is a form of animation which uses Microsoft PowerPoint and similar programs to create a game or movie. The artwork is generally created using PowerPoint's AutoShape features, and then animated slide-by-slide or by using Custom Animation.
The Graphics Interchange Format (GIF; / ɡ ɪ f / GHIF or / dʒ ɪ f / JIF, see § Pronunciation) is a bitmap image format that was developed by a team at the online services provider CompuServe led by American computer scientist Steve Wilhite and released on June 15, 1987.
Corel Presentations can create effective and in-depth presentations. This program includes a number of templates and different types of slide shows to help to lay out a show. The templates include a set background, font, color and set up of the slide. These defaults can be changed within the slide show.

The PNG (Portable Network Graphics) file format was created as a free, open-source alternative to GIF.
